Kansas WW2 NMCG Casualty List – F Surnames

FAHRING, Ivan Lee, Seaman 2c, USNR. Father, Mr. Thomas Earl Fahring, Gypsum.

FAIRBANKS, Carl Douglas, Fireman 1c, USN. Parents, Mr. and Mrs. Frank Lester Fairbanks, Rt. 1, Emmett.

FANNING, Orville Franklin, Jr., Ship’s Cook 3c, USNR. Parents, Mr. and Mrs. Orville Franklin Fanning, Sr., Rt. 5, North Topeka.

FARABEE, Albert Eugene, Torpedoman’s Mate 3c, USNR. Father, Mr. Jess George Farabee, Sr., 3314 Holmes St., Kansas City.

FAST, John Arthur, Pharmacist’s Mate 3c, USN. Father, Mr. Edmond O. Fast, 331 Ellis Ave., Wichita.

FAUBION, Denzel J., Pfc., USMCR. Parents, Mr. and Mrs. Wilbur L. Faubion, 390 Fourth St., Phillipsburg.

FAULKNER, Maurice L., Cpl., USMC. Father, Mr. Carroll W. Faulkner, 1555 Ferrell Drive, Wichita.

FAZENDIN, James William, Electrician’s Mate 3c, USN. Father, Mr. Ray Fazendin, Willis.

FEATHERINGILL, John Philip, Lieutenant (jg), USNR. Mother, Mrs. Clara Jones Featheringill, Rt. 4, Independence.

FEESE, Harold Chester, Chief Electrician’s Mate, USN. Wife, Mrs. Vida Theal Feese, Arlington.

FELDKAMP, Leo Herman, Seaman 1c, USNR. Parents, Mr. and Mrs. George William Feldkamp, Rt. 1, Lincoln.

FIELDS, Curtis Elmer, Shipfitter 1c, USNR. Parents, Mr. and Mrs. Buck Fields, Box 227, Baldwin City.

FIELDS, John Henry, Gunner’s Mate 3c, USN. Wife, Mrs. Mary Ellen Fields, 802 Osage Ave., Kansas City.

FISHER, James Patrick, Aviation Metalsmith 2c, USNR. Mother, Mrs. Margaret Ellen Fisher, 1151 Medford, Topeka.

FISHER, Raymond Eugene, Seaman 2c, USNR. Mother, Mrs. Zona Fisher, 1026 No. Kansas Ave., Topeka.

FITTS, Asa Edward, Motor Machinist’s Mate 3c, USNR. Parents, Mr. and Mrs. Gordon Garland Fitts, Argonia.

FLACK, Loren Waley, Seaman 1c, USN. Mother, Mrs. Lula Matthews, Elsmore.

FLEMING, Joe Ely, Lieutenant, USNR. Wife, Mrs. Kathryn Lucille Fleming, Reading.

FLETCHER, Jack Vernon, Fireman 2c, USNR. Wife, Mrs. Patricia Carroll Fletcher, 519 E. A, Hutchinson.

FLINN, Dewey J., Sgt., USMC. Parents, Mr. and Mrs. Joseph T. Flinn, 2146 So. Broadway, Wichita.

FLOREA, Randall Finis, Aviation Radioman 3c, USNR. Parents, Mr. and Mrs. Earl G. Florea, Lucas.

FLOYD, Howard A., Pvt., USMCR. Parents, Mr. and Mrs. Elight W. Floyd, Gen. Del., Argonia.

FLYNN, John Joseph, Pharmacist’s Mate 3c, USNR. Parents, Mr. and Mrs. William S. Flynn, 1514 Stone, Great Bend.

FORD, Joel LeRoy, Seaman 1c, USN. Wife, Mrs. Betty Ford, 138 So. 3rd St., Salina.

FOSTER, Clarence Clinton, Machinist’s Mate 2c, USN. Parents, Mr. and Mrs. Edgar Ray Foster, 709 Main St., Blue Rapids.

FOSTER, Ralph Eugene, Seaman 1c, USN. Mother, Mrs. Elsie Maude Foster, 2110 Gilmore, Kansas City.

FOWLER, David Harriman, Electrician’s Mate 3c, USNR. Parents, Mr. and Mrs. Joel Fowler, 745 Grant St., Lawrence.

FRAHM, Lyle Richard, 2nd Lieutenant, USMCR. Wife, Mrs. Leah D. Frahm, Rt. 1, Detroit.

FRANTZ, Harlan Milton, Storekeeper 3c, USN. Parents, Mr. and Mrs. Fred Milton Frantz, Junction City.

FRAZIER, Glenn Junior, Aviation Ordnanceman 2c, USNR. Mother, Mrs. Doroth Frazier, Lake Quivera, Kansas City.

FREAD, Clyde Dale, Chief Shipfitter, USNR. Wife, Mrs. Martha Barbara Fread, Rural Rt., Gorham.

FREEMAN, Everett Wayne, Jr., Aviation Machinist’s Mate 1c, USN. Father, Mr. Everett Wayne Freeman, Sr., Box 565, Colby.

FREEL, Billy Bob, Pfc., USMC. Parents, Mr. and Mrs. James R. Freel, 826 Winfield Ave., Topeka.

FRENCH, Loyd Joseph, Seaman 2c, USN. Mother, Mrs. Ruth L. Bond, Rt. 1, Muncie.

FREY, John Hubert, Watertender 3c, USNR. Son and daughter, John Arless and Linda Gail Frey, c/o Roberta Boyd, 807 7th St., Garden City.


Collection:
Department of the Navy. Bureau of Naval Personnel. State Summary of War Casualties from World War II for Navy, Marine Corps, and Coast Guard. Item from Record Group 24: Records of the Bureau of Naval Personnel.
